Hydraulic Gradient Line Formula . Hgl = p / γ + h (4) where The hydraulic grade line is a graph of the pressure and gravitational heads plotted along the position of the pipeline or channel. The head distribution and interpolated equipotential lines can be used to calculate a hydraulic gradient at any location. Calculating the hydraulic gradient between two points involves finding the head at the origin (h 1), and the head at a point of interest (h 2).
